Humidity and Weather Changes:

One of the primary culprits behind sudden frizz is humidity. When the air is humid, moisture from the atmosphere penetrates the hair shaft, causing the strands to swell and resulting in frizz. Similarly, sudden weather changes, such as going from a dry environment to a humid one, can cause the hair to react and frizz up.

Solution: To combat frizz caused by humidity, use anti-frizz products containing ingredients like silicone or polymers that create a protective barrier on the hair shaft. Additionally, styling your hair in up dos or braids can help minimize the exposure of your hair to humidity.

Lack of Moisture:

When hair lacks moisture, it becomes more susceptible to frizz. Dry hair tends to absorb moisture from the environment, leading to frizz and flyaway. Factors that contribute to dryness include excessive heat styling, over washing, and using harsh hair products.

Solution: Hydrate your hair by incorporating moisturizing products into your hair care routine. Use a hydrating shampoo and conditioner, and consider applying a live-in conditioner or hair oil to lock in moisture. Limit the use of heat styling tools and opt for air drying whenever possible.

Damaged Hair Cuticles:

Hair cuticles act as a protective layer, sealing in moisture and keeping the hair smooth. However, damage to the cuticles can cause them to lift, resulting in frizz. Common causes of cuticle damage include excessive heat styling, chemical treatments, and rough handling of the hair.

Using the wrong hair care products, such as those containing harsh chemicals or high levels of alcohol, can strip the hair of its natural oils, leading to dryness and frizz. Additionally, using heavy products that weigh down the hair can also contribute to frizz.

Solution: Choose hair care products specifically formulated for your hair type and concerns. Look for products labeled as “moisturizing,” “smoothing,” or “anti-frizz.” Avoid products with sulfates, alcohol, and high levels of silicone. Opt for lightweight and nourishing formulas that provide hydration without weighing down the hair.
